STEP 1: Find the terminal point

In the unit circle, Ф is the angle between the terminal side and the positive part of the x-axis.

Rule 1: The terminal point on the positive part of the x-axis is (1, 0),which means Ф = 0 or 2π radians and cosФ = 1, sinФ = 0

Rule 2: The terminal point on the positive part of the y-axis is (0, 1),which means Ф = radians and cosФ = 0, sinФ = 1

Rule 3: The terminal point on the negative part of the x-axis is (-1, 0),which means Ф = π radians and cosФ = -1, sinФ = 0

Rule 4: The terminal point on the negative part of the y-axis is (0, -1),which means Ф = radians and cosФ = 0, sinФ = -1
